I am the guy you saw last season. Had my pocket troller since 1989 and have no plans for getting a bigger boat. It's perfect for handtrolling if you stay near a buyer. Only uses about 3 gallons per day of fuel, and is exempt from many CG requirements because of its size.
However, the boat you saw listed is not suitable for commercial fishing. In order to have more cabin space, they put the engine where the fish hold should be. It doesn't have a pit either. Would be a great cruiser though.
Supposedly they built over 50 of these boats before they went bankrupt, so you may come across one that is set up for its original purpose...
